Output 7e95ecc7435aeeb3b14deba87e586c90806f8d9b4ba7af87242c8bcc491f1936:17

value
745590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7ed333beb871a48d54c8233a6aabbdf5456270 OP_EQUAL
address
3BagqDZvh8ZK4eH9GTJ3jQYwbyAHnHHgZK
transaction
7e95ecc7435aeeb3b14deba87e586c90806f8d9b4ba7af87242c8bcc491f1936
spent
true